## Break-Glass: GateTally Turnstile Counter

Quick guide for security reviewers. GateTally counts entries at Harrowfen Arena, and on match days a stuck counter means real crowd-safety risk, so we keep a break-glass path. Use it only when both normal admins are unreachable and gates are live. Every use pages the Wrenmoor duty lead and gets audited within 24 hours. To open the emergency console, enter the recovery passphrase shown below.

unlock words, kagef-taduf: fenir-quenix-norwyn-sorvan-gormir-gorir-fraok

## Further Reading

So you've inherited GateTally, our turnstile counter for Bramblewick Arena. The short version: counts come in over the gate mesh, get deduped, and land in the occupancy dashboard. When numbers look weird, it's almost always a stuck sensor at the north concourse. Debounce logic and sensor quirks are documented properly elsewhere. For the full troubleshooting guide and escalation steps, start with the internal page here.

wiki page, bawef-hafop: https://jira.nelvroworks.corp/job/pages/projects/7c5c0f440dbd

For the sync: tracked the fd leak in Bramblehost's sidecar to the metrics exporter — sockets opened per scrape, closed only on happy path. Error branch returned early, skipping close. Fixed with deferred cleanup plus an fd watchdog that logs when usage crosses a soft ceiling. Soak test over the weekend held flat at ~240 fds vs. the previous climb to exhaustion in six hours. Follow-up: audit the two other exporters copied from this code. Watchdog thresholds and ulimits are now set as follows.

tuning table, faduf-baduf:
PRIORITIES = {
    "ulavan": 191,
    "silys": 750,
    "goriel": 238,
    "kelmir": 66,
    "wendor": 432,
}

Ticket PAIRO-2214: GC pauses in the Matchgrove pairing service. Since the Tuesday deploy we see stop-the-world pauses up to 1.8s during peak matching, blowing the 500ms budget. Heap dumps show candidate graphs retained past request scope, likely the new cache in the scorer. Proposal for the eng sync: revert the cache, then reintroduce with weak references. Repro is reliable on the affected build, whose token follows below.

pipeline stamp: htk3_69f